Abstract | This curriculum guide was developed to provide environmental education through a series of hands-on activities for the classroom and the outdoor setting of Weymouth Woods-Sandhills Nature Preserve, North Carolina. This activity packet, designed for grades 5 and 6, meets established curriculum objectives of the North Carolina Department of Public Instruction's Standard Course of Study. Students are exposed to the following major concepts: classification of plants, life cycle of a longleaf pine, methods of determining the age of trees, benefits of natural and prescribed fires to the longleaf pine, and ways the trees have adapted to fire. The packet is divided into eight sections: (1) introduction to the North Carolina State Parks System, Weymouth Woods-Sandhills Nature Preserve, and the activity packet; (2) activity summary; (3) pre-visit activities; (4) on-site activities; (5) post-visit activities; (6) vocabulary and definitions; (7) references; and (8) a scheduling worksheet, parental permission form, and program evaluation. Activity information includes curriculum objectives for each grade level, location, group size, estimated time, appropriate season, materials, major concepts, objectives, educator's information, student's information, and worksheets.
